Welcome to the Japanese Program of the Division of Modern Languages and Linguistics at Florida State College. FSU is residence to one of the vital robust and large-ranging curriculums in Japanese language and tradition in the state of Florida. We provide a full 4 years of rigorous Japanese language instruction—from starting Japanese to intermediate and advanced programs in dialog, composition, grammar, and reading. We additionally supply courses—taught in English translation—on Japanese literature from the classical interval by means of the trendy and contemporary eras, Japanese film and media, and Japanese fashionable tradition (including manga and anime). These courses educate students easy methods to suppose imaginatively in addition to critically about Japanese culture from native and international perspectives, giving college students opportunities to reinforce their cross-cultural awareness and to grow as citizens of the world. On New Yr's Eve, just earlier than midnight, there is a Japanese cultural tradition of consuming "toshikoshi soba" or soba noodles to greet the brand new 12 months. Consuming the long soba noodles is said to be a prayer for having a long and fruitful life. Then, if there’s a temple nearby, you’ll hear the deep gong of the temple bell ring out at the stroke of midnight.


In contrast to Christmas celebrations, 日本史 家系図 the place decorations are packed away and used once more the following year, Japanese New 12 months decorations have to be model new to symbolise transferring away from the past. Shimekazari particularly are a decoration made from sacred Shinto rice, straw rope, pine twigs and zig-zagged paper strips called shide. They’re normally hung on the entrance door of properties, outlets and eating places straight after Christmas, with the purpose of preserving away unhealthy spirits. Japanese curry is kind of completely different from the Indian curries that you is likely to be familiar with. Japanese curry has a candy taste and is ready like a stew; meat and vegetables are cooked together with a curry paste that acts as a thickening agent.
